Camila Cabello Finalizes Her Debut Album Tracklist: See Her Announcement

Ahead of her January 12 release date, Camila Cabello has finally unleashed the tracklist for her forthcoming solo debut via Epic Records and that means we're one step closer to the budding star's full circle transformation from Fifth Harmony bandmate to solo pop superstar.

On Thursday afternoon (December 21), the 20-year-old star took to Instagram to share the 10-song tracklist, which includes the previously released "Never Be The Same," "Real Friends" and, of course, her smash single, "Havana." Elsewhere on the set, there are titles like "All These Years," Something's Gotta Give," "In The Dark" and "Into it."

Earlier this month, Cabello offered her fans with the first live performance of "Never Be The Same" at Z100's Jingle Ball in New York City. Simultaneously, the budding star also helped launched a brand-new campaign called Project YouDoYou during the Big Apple affair.

Project YouDoYou is aimed at empowering young women through inspirational stories and life experiences. The goal of the campaign is to help GenZ girls shape a positive mentality alongside some mentors. Participants of the project will have even bigger roles than they can imagine as they'll be featured in the original series. Expect to see Project YouDoYou work with major outlets such as Teen Vogue, Buzzfeed, Canvas Media and Wasserman Media in 2018.
